博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Objective C基础教程 第一章 启程
阅读量:6710 次
发布时间:2019-06-25

本文共 1071 字,大约阅读时间需要 3 分钟。

本书旨在介绍Objective-C的基础知识。Objective-C是C语言的一个扩展集。可以开发Mac OSX的应用和iPhone应用。本书介绍Objective-C语言及苹果公司为其提供的Cocoa工具包。 ##1.1预备知识       在阅读本书之前,读者应该具有其他与C类似的编程语言的基础(如:C++、Java或者C)。熟悉其基本原理。理解什么是函数和变量。知道如何使用循环语句和分支语句。这本书将介绍Objective-C在其基础语言C中添加的特性,及Cocoa工具包的一些优秀的特性。       如果不具备C语言基础的小伙伴可以先去学习C语言哟。 ##1.2历史背景       Cocoa是苹果公司Mac OS X操作系统的核心。早在20世纪80年代早期,Brad Cox就发明了Objective-C。1985年 Steve Jobs 创立了NeXT公司。NeXT选择Unix作为其操作系统,创建了NextSTEP(使用Objective-C开发的一款强大的用户界面工具包)。NextSTEP只是创造了一些特性,拥有少量拥趸,并未在商业上获得成功。       在苹果公司1996年收购NeXT之后,NextSTEP被正式命名为Cocoa,并得到了Macintosh编程人员的广泛认可。苹果公司免费提供其开发工具(包括Cocoa)任何Mac编程人员都可以使用。 ##1.3内容介绍       Objective-C是C的一个扩展集。Objective-C以C语言为基础,在该语言中添加了一些微妙但意义重大的特性。       第2章着重介绍Objective-C引入的基本特性。       第3章介绍面向对象编程的基础知识。       第4章介绍如何创建具有其父类特性的类。       第5章讨论结合对象协同工作的技巧。       第6章介绍创建程序源文件的实际策略。       第7章介绍一些快捷方法和强大特性,帮助你最大程度的提高编程效率。       第8章介绍Cocoa的两个主要框架之一,加深你对Cocoa中一些优秀特性的理解。       第9章介绍Cocoa应用程序。       第10章讨论对象的初始化       第11章介绍Objective-C中新增的点表示法以及构建对象访问方法的一种简单方式。       第12章介绍Objective-C中的一个非常出色的特性:支持在现有的类中添加自己的方法,甚至可以添加别人编写的方法。       第13章介绍Objective-C中的一种继承方式,这种方式允许类实现打包的特性集。       第14章介绍如何使用Cocoa的另一个主要框架开发优秀的应用程序。       第15章介绍如何保存和检索数据。       第16章介绍如何间接操作数据。       第17章介绍如何分解数据。

转载地址:http://jlalo.baihongyu.com/

你可能感兴趣的文章
去芜存精:如何选择最优质的CRM软件研发商?
查看>>
为精简成本 诺基亚将在芬兰本土进行裁员
查看>>
实现数据科学研究结果可复制的十条规则
查看>>
智能家居行业步入死胡同 未来何去何从?
查看>>
《HTML 5与CSS 3权威指南(第3版·下册)》——19.2 属性选择器
查看>>
意法半导体:加大中国市场投入 重点布局物联网/车联网
查看>>
一场百万级别的电子盛事是如何造就的?
查看>>
测试框架的利好和繁荣:Java单元测试框架之争
查看>>
成功的CIO是怎样炼成的?
查看>>
物联网大数据行业应用分析
查看>>
爱立信移动报告预测:2022年全球5G用户将达5.5亿
查看>>
如何增强虚拟机平台兼容性?
查看>>
中科院成功制备出可穿戴传感器
查看>>
IT经理、IT总监、CIO的区别
查看>>
Convertlab获春晓资本数千万元A轮融资,国内营销云拉开帷幕
查看>>
中国半导体要从点到面,存储器为何是最好下手点?
查看>>
数据中心对洪水风险应具备应急措施
查看>>
网络安全领袖施奈尔:政府更多地参与网络安全不可避免
查看>>
OpenSSL将于9月22日发布多个漏洞补丁
查看>>
Win10失误推送Build 16212系统更新:用户悲剧!
查看>>